How Our Subfloor Water Extraction Process Works
We understand that every water damage situation is unique, which is why we take a tailored approach to subfloor water extraction. Our process begins with a thorough assessment of the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. From there, our team gets to work extracting the water and drying the subfloor using high-powered equipment.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We work with you to find out the best course of action for your specific situation. This may involve inspecting the affected area, taking photos, and documenting the dam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use specialized equipment to extract the standing water from your subfloor. This is a crucial step in preventing further damage and mold growth.
Step 3: Subfloor Drying
We use high-powered equipment to dry your subfloor,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This helps to prevent mold growth and ensures your subfloor is dry within 3-5 days.
Step 4: Disinfection and Sanitizing
We disinfect and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
We work with you to restore your property to its original condition, including any necessary repairs or reconstruction.

Warning Signs You Need Subfloor Water Extraction
Beyond the obvious signs of standing water, there are other warning signs that show you need subfloor water extraction. Don’t ignore these subtle signs, which can lead to costly repairs and health risks.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a musty smell in your home, it’s time to call our team for subfloor water extraction.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Damp or wet flooring can lead to warping or buckling. If you notice this in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ains can show a more significant problem, such as a leaky pipe or a roof issue. Don’t ignore these stains, as they can lead to costly repairs.
Increased Humidity or Moisture
High humidity or moisture levels in your home can create an ideal environment for mold and mildew growth. If you notice this in your home, it’s time to call our team for subfloor water extraction.
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ew
Visible signs of mold or mildew can show a more significant problem. Don’t wait until it’s too late, trust our team to provide expert subfloor water extraction services in Sansom Park, TX.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ks in your home can show a more significant issue, such as a structural problem or a hidden leak.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s.
Subfloor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(<1 gallon) |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small spill on your own. |
| Water damage affecting a small area (<10 sq ft) | Maybe | Yes | A small area can be tricky to dry, and a pro can ensure the job is done right. |
| Water damage affecting a large area (>10 sq ft) | No | Yes | A large area need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ry correctly. |
| Standing water (up to 2 inches deep) | No | Yes | Standing water needs specialized equipment to extract and dry correctly. |
| Water damage with structural issues (e.g., warping floorboards) | No | Yes | Structural issues need a pro to ensure the damage is repaired correctly. |
| Water damage with m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ew need spec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ely and effectively. |
While some situations may seem DIY-friendly, it’s essential to remember that subfloor water extraction need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ure the job is done correctly. Subfloor Water Extraction Cost in Sansom Park, TX
The cost of subfloor water extraction in Sansom Park,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. On average, the cost can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$1,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ted. |
| Subfloor Drying | $1,000 – $3,000 | The size of the affected area and the amount of equipment required. |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$200 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the type of disinfectant used. |
| Restoration and Repair | $1,500 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of materials required for repair. |
| Emergency Service (after hours or weekend) | 15% – 20% extra | The time and resources required for emergency service. |
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ation. We offer free estimates and on-site consultations to provide a more accurate quote for your subfloor water extraction project.
